Operators
Specify the type of arithmetic operation to be performed on the data. The operator priority is the same as for scripts.
For details, refer to Chapter 20 “6.4 About the Priority of the Operator” on page 20-55.

Input Examples
Description
@ + 1
To perform the arithmetic operation and input the result, add 1 to the value entered
using the Keypad and write the result to the device.
To perform the arithmetic operation and display the result, add 1 to the value of device
and display the result.
[LDR 0] + @ + 100
To perform the arithmetic operation and input the result, add the value of LDR0 to the
value entered using the Keypad and add 100, and write the result to the device.
To perform the arithmetic operation and display the result, add the value of LDR0 to the
value of device and add 100, then display the result.
@ & 3
To perform the arithmetic operation and input the result, write the logical product of the
value entered using the Keypad and 3 to the device.
